canadian-homes-section *{padding:0;margin:0}canadian-homes-section .chs__container{padding:1.8rem 2.4rem 3.4rem;background:#fff}canadian-homes-section .chs__content{overflow:hidden}canadian-homes-section .chs__title-box{display:flex;flex-direction:column;text-align:left;margin-bottom:1.2rem}canadian-homes-section .chs__title_1{color:#000;font-family:DM Sans,ui-sans-serif,system-ui,sans-serif;font-size:32px;font-style:normal;font-weight:700;line-height:100%}canadian-homes-section .chs__title_2{color:#b67034;font-family:Libre Caslon Text;font-size:32px;font-style:normal;font-weight:400;line-height:100%}canadian-homes-section .chs__item{background-color:#fff}canadian-homes-section .chs__item-image{display:flex}canadian-homes-section .chs__item-image img{width:100%;height:100%}canadian-homes-section .chs__item-featured-product-image img{width:100%;object-fit:contain;height:auto}canadian-homes-section .chs__item-image img{width:100%;height:245px;object-fit:cover}canadian-homes-section .chs__item-featured-product{display:flex;gap:1.6rem;text-decoration:none}canadian-homes-section .chs__item-featured-product-title{color:#000;font-family:DM Sans,ui-sans-serif,system-ui,sans-serif;font-size:1.6rem;font-style:normal;font-weight:400;line-height:150%}canadian-homes-section .chs__item-review{display:flex;flex-direction:column;gap:.7rem}canadian-homes-section .chs__item-content{padding:1.2rem 2.4rem 2.4rem}canadian-homes-section .chs__item-review-text{color:#111;font-family:DM Sans,ui-sans-serif,system-ui,sans-serif;font-size:14px;font-style:normal;font-weight:400;line-height:150%}canadian-homes-section .chs__item-featured-product-image{min-width:20%;max-width:25%}canadian-homes-section .chs__item-review-author{color:#111;font-family:DM Sans,ui-sans-serif,system-ui,sans-serif;font-size:14px;font-style:normal;font-weight:700;line-height:150%}canadian-homes-section .chs__item-review-author em{font-size:14px;font-style:italic;font-weight:400}canadian-homes-section .chs__item-featured-product{width:100%;padding:1.2rem .8rem}canadian-homes-section .chs__item-featured-product-content{display:flex;flex-direction:column;gap:.8rem}canadian-homes-section .chs__item-featured-product-content .badge--refurb{order:unset}canadian-homes-section .chs__item-featured-product-price{border-radius:4px;border-top:1px solid #f1efec;padding-top:8px}canadian-homes-section .chs__item-featured-product-price .product-card__financing-info{display:none}canadian-homes-section .product-card__financing-info,canadian-homes-section body div .product-card__financing-info{font-size:10px;display:flex;gap:8px}canadian-homes-section .product-card__financing-info strong,canadian-homes-section body div .product-card__financing-info strong{font-size:10px}canadian-homes-section .chs__swiper-buttons{position:relative;display:flex;gap:1.6rem;padding-top:2.4rem;z-index:1}canadian-homes-section .chs__swiper-buttons .swiper-button-prev,canadian-homes-section .chs__swiper-buttons .swiper-button-next{margin-top:0;padding:1rem;width:4rem;height:4rem;display:flex;align-items:center;justify-content:center;background-color:#fff;border-radius:50%;position:static}canadian-homes-section .chs__swiper-buttons .swiper-button-prev:after,canadian-homes-section .chs__swiper-buttons .swiper-button-next:after{display:none;content:none}canadian-homes-section .chs__swiper-buttons .swiper-button-prev svg path,canadian-homes-section .chs__swiper-buttons .swiper-button-next svg path{fill:#000}canadian-homes-section .chs__swiper-buttons .swiper-button-prev svg{transform:rotate(90deg)}canadian-homes-section .chs__swiper-buttons .swiper-button-next svg{transform:rotate(-90deg)}canadian-homes-section .chs__swiper-buttons .swiper-button-prev{padding:1rem 1.1rem 1rem .9rem}canadian-homes-section .chs__swiper-buttons .swiper-button-next{padding:1rem .9rem 1rem 1.1rem}canadian-homes-section .chs__title-and-arrows{display:flex;justify-content:space-between;align-items:center}canadian-homes-section .chs__title-icon{display:inline-block;margin-top:0}canadian-homes-section .chs__item-review-stars svg{width:18px;height:18px}@media only screen and (max-width: 990px){canadian-homes-section .chs__title-icon{width:28px;height:28px}canadian-homes-section .chs__title-icon svg{width:100%;height:100%}canadian-homes-section .chs__item-featured-product-price{margin-bottom:1.8rem}}@media only screen and (max-width: 415px){canadian-homes-section .new-price{font-size:18px}canadian-homes-section .old-price,canadian-homes-section .percent-saved{font-size:16px}}@media only screen and (min-width: 769px){canadian-homes-section .chs__item.swiper-slide{max-width:435px;min-height:var(--max-height);width:100%}canadian-homes-section .chs__item-featured-product-price .price-discounted-price-box .inner-price-container--new-price .new-price{font-size:18px}canadian-homes-section .chs__item-featured-product-price .price-discounted-price-box .inner-price-container--retail-price .old-price,canadian-homes-section .chs__item-featured-product-price .price-discounted-price-box .inner-price-container--you-save .percent-saved{font-size:16px}}@media only screen and (min-width: 920px){canadian-homes-section .chs__item-image img{height:280px}canadian-homes-section .chs__title-box{display:block;text-align:left;margin-bottom:2.4rem;display:flex;align-items:center;gap:.8rem;flex-wrap:wrap;flex-direction:row}canadian-homes-section .chs__title_1{display:block;font-size:5.1rem;line-height:1.1}canadian-homes-section .chs__title_2{font-size:5.1rem;line-height:1}canadian-homes-section .chs__title-icon svg{width:41px;height:41px}canadian-homes-section .chs__swiper-container{display:flex;flex-direction:column-reverse}canadian-homes-section .chs__swiper-buttons{padding-top:0;margin-bottom:2.4rem}canadian-homes-section .chs__swiper-buttons .swiper-button-prev,canadian-homes-section .chs__swiper-buttons .swiper-button-next{background-color:#2a351b}canadian-homes-section .chs__swiper-buttons .swiper-button-prev svg path,canadian-homes-section .chs__swiper-buttons .swiper-button-next svg path{fill:#fff}canadian-homes-section .chs__item-featured-product-image img{width:100%;object-fit:contain;max-height:193px}canadian-homes-section .chs__swiper-buttons{padding-right:1.6rem}canadian-homes-section .price .price-saving .price-discounted-price-box{padding-left:0}}@media only screen and (min-width: 1200px){canadian-homes-section .chs__container{padding-left:190px;padding-right:0}}canadian-homes-section .js-only-left{display:none!important}
/*# sourceMappingURL=/cdn/shop/t/331/assets/canadian-homes.css.map */
